About the Book

Crystal’s Solid Gold Discovery, Book 2, another kids mystery adventure in the Crystal Blake Adventures series by Stephen and Janet Bly

While spending a week with her father in the north Idaho mountains, fourteen-year-old Crystal stumbles into a kids mystery adventure as she helps uncover a fraudulent plot involving an abandoned gold mine.

When Crystal Blake discovers the deserted gold mine, she decides to explore. But if it’s deserted, why is there a helicopter landing pad beside it? And why is smoke coming from the smokestack? Maybe Crystal’s plan of a quiet week of vacation in rural Idaho, learning to ride her new horse, and getting to know handsome Shawn Sorensen better, won’t happen quite like she expected. Meanwhile, she discovers a burlap bag buried in the middle of a field. When she carefully cuts into it, not sure what she’ll find inside, she realizes It’s not squishy at all. What spills out is heavy, metal, very old, and very broken. She and her dad try to solve the mystery as she wonders what weird thing is happening with Shawn.

Excerpt from kids mystery adventure Crystal’s Solid Gold Discovery:

“Don’t tell Stephanie about Shawn, because she’ll tell Sheila Edwards right away, and I want to tell her myself. And if you see Mr. Pellner, tell him I’ll be out for volleyball practice as soon as I get home.” Crystal took a breath before continuing her last-minute instructions as Megan’s flight to California began boarding. “And …”

“Whoa!” Megan said as she grabbed her carry-on bag and headed to the gate. “I’ve got to go.”

Crystal waved, and suddenly Megan was gone. The jet taxied down the runway as fourteen-year-old Crystal and her dad left the parking lot. “We’ll, it’s just you and me kid,” Mr. Blake remarked with a sideways smile.

“You and me and Caleb, ” Crystal added, trying to cheer herself up. With her best friend Megan gone, there’s be just she and her dad for one more week in Idaho. And her new prize. The wonder of it all hit Crystal again. She was truly the owner of her very own horse.
